They’re calling it the Dragonfruit Freeze and it looks outstanding, especially since the color is pink!

Courtesy of Taco Bell

The new Dragonfruit Freeze includes a dragonfruit base that has swirls of pink dragon fruit flavor. The mixture supposedly tastes like a cross between a kiwi and a pear which I’ve personally never mixed, but I don’t doubt any flavor combination when it comes to Taco Bell!

If you look closely on Taco Bell’s menu, there’s also an option to order a Dragonfruit Freeze with no syrup so in this case, your drink will come out like a frosty white color without the notes of pink.

You can currently get the Dragonfruit Freeze at participating locations for a limited time in a regular size for $2.39 and a large for $2.59. The drink is also available for just $1 during Happier Hour from 2 to 5 p.m. also at participating Taco Bells.
